Instead of finding just inspiration, she finds the sheriff Dylan, and her libido awakens even though she doesn't want it to. She likes him and she likes his 8-year-old son too. He is determined to follow the single path until his boy is much older. However, he is so tempted by Hope who is everything he never wanted. Dylan has a secret about his son's mother that he just can't let out it.

This is just a lovely delightful book with a single dad sheriff in a small town and a California reporter hiding out and looking for inspiration. After her divorce a few years ago, she still feels broken, but her writing career for a tabloid magazine was going okay. Then her inspiration dried up so her editor made her take a break out into the small town of Gospel.
